The International Olympic Committee announces that participation in women's events will be limited to athletes classified as female based on biological criteria, with eligibility determined through a one-time genetic test starting from the 2028 Olympic Games. The policy replaces previous rules that allowed individual sports federations to set their own criteria.
The development was among the significant sport stories being followed from World. Contemporary coverage attributed the principal details to AFP via ABS-CBN News on 26 March 2026.
